(1) Except as otherwise provided in subsections (2), (5), (6), and (7), a filed financing statement is effective for a period of 5 years after the date of filing.
UCC is an abbreviation for the ?Uniform Commercial Code,? which governs the transfer of Security Interests in personal property pursuant to state law.
NOTICE: Following an opinion issued by the Indiana Attorney General, effective January 1, 2021, UCC Recording fees are $35.00 including Financing Statements, Amendments, and Information Requests regardless of page count. UCC's will receive the same instrument number format as all other recorded documents.
